Luis Enrique: "I’m very happy with what I saw"
The Paris Saint-Germain coach as well as Carlos Soler spoke to PSG TV following Les Parisiens' 2-0 win over FC Metz at the Stade Saint-Symphorien on Matchday 34 of Ligue 1 tonight.
LUIS ENRIQUE
“This kind of game is generally tough, but I think that the team played to a very high standard tonight. We were professional and had the right mindset to compete, and I’m very happy with what I saw and with the team’s performance. When you play for a club as big as Paris Saint-Germain, you need to be at 100% in every game. I think that tonight, we deserved to win again, and we’re happy.
"Now, we want to end the season in the best way possible. We know that [the Coupe de France final] is a big game in France and a very important trophy, and we’re hoping to make our fans happy once again and to celebrate a third title this season. That would be wonderful and the best way to end the season.”
Carlos Soler
"We had a good first half, played really well and created a lot of chances. We finished the season with a win, which was important for us. I scored early in the game, which I’m happy about."
